Output f5129bbce5a35b8b4a02b41cedf1326c7daaae9c3b39c808f371b8bcccf94e04:2

value
10033
script pubkey
OP_0 OP_PUSHBYTES_20 bdcd9e8d971f10fc19dc1b984d25575a66491616
address
tb1qhhxearvhrug0cxwurwvy6f2htfnyj9skxm02ny
transaction
f5129bbce5a35b8b4a02b41cedf1326c7daaae9c3b39c808f371b8bcccf94e04
confirmations
25612
spent
true